EU Oettinger Won't Rule Out Opening Oil Reserves In Iran Dispute

ESSEN, Germany -(Dow Jones) -- The European Union is working on plans to ensure security of energy supply--including opening member states' strategic oil reserves--if deliveries from Iran were to suddenly cease amid an ongoing dispute over the country's nuclear weapons program, said the EU's energy chief Guenther Oettinger at an industry conference here Monday.

We are working on plans that would help us ensure security of supply, if Iran were to stop delivering oil before the EU embargo against the country kicks in July," said Oettinger.

Asked if these plans also include tapping emergency stocks, Oettinger said that such a move couldn't be ruled out.

However, he also said that the EU believes that any supply disruptions could also be mitigated by channeling oil through the EU's existing pipeline network
